Monday 20th June - Cannock Round-Up

It was a good evening's football in the Cannock Monday 6 a side league this week, with all teams in attendance throughout the night , the only exceptions being Club Bates and Allison Wonderland, both of which return on Monday 27th June.

We are pleased to welcome new team Half Pump and Dribble FC to the Premier Division this week!  They take the vacancy in the Premier Division and we wish them good luck in their first fixture on Monday 27th June as they take on Cannock Young Boys.

There is a new leader in the Premier Division this week as Harchester United suffered a surprise 5-2 reverse at the hands of Sporting Bad Haircuts, allowing Peasports to move two points clear at the summit, they took full advantage as they won a closely fought encounter 3-2 against Skillage In The Village!  Cannock Young Boys boosted their survival hopes this week as they picked up an impressive 3-1 win over third placed Aston Villagers.

Division One leaders River Plate dented PG's promotion hopes this week as they won a competitive game 3-1, a result which sees PG drop to fourth in the table as Gem Carpets 5-0 win and Borussia Teeth's 4-1 victory over Karius To Glory moved both up a place in the table, with Borussia now occupying the second promotion spot.  Nice to Michu put 2 points between them and second bottom Thiago X Silva who they beat by 4 goals to 1 this week to boost their survival chances.

Bridge Rejects got a 5-0 win this week to stay top of Division Two, and although being held to a 3-3 draw by bottom side Swan FC, Sevilla Depression sneaked into the second promotion place above Allison Wonderland who forfeited.  The Arcade Cannock picked up a vital 2-1 win over The Special Ones this week which keeps them in touching distance of survival, as the team just above them Barsport were 5-2 winners against Harriers.

Division Three leaders It Was Just Matip continue their title charge as they were 4-2 winners against Bazikstan FC this week, they still remain a point clear of second placed Real Sosobad who won by the same scoreline against Beacon Bombs as the two battle it out for the title.  Red Hot Chilli Knackers lost ground on the promotion places after they were beaten 3-2 by Pathetico Madrid in a surprise result, they are now three points off second place.  Elsewhere, Lallanas In Pyjamas put in a steely performance to move up to fifth place as they edged a close encounter against Sheffield Monday by a goal to nil.
